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Don’t ignore these signs they can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Catching water damage early saves you money and prevents b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ice persistent smells, it’s time to investigate and address the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Visible signs of water damage, such as warped or buckled flooring, need immediate attention to prevent further damage and safety hazards.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age behind the surface. Don’t delay, investigate and address the issue to prevent costly repairs.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Visible water stains can show a more extensive problem. Don’t ignore these signs, investigate and address the issue to prevent further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ks can show structural damage or hidden moisture. If you notice these signs, it’s time to investigate and address the issue.
Office Building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age with no visible signs of mold | Yes | No | You can try to dry the area yourself, but be sure to monitor for signs of mold growth. |
| Water damage with visible signs of mold | No | Yes | Mold needs professional remediation to ensure a healthy and safe environment. |
| Water damage in a large office space or commercial building |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to handle large-scale water damage. |
| Water damage with structural damage or safety hazards | No | Yes | Structural damage or safety hazards need immediate attention from a professional. |
| Water damage with unknown sources or hidden moisture |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to detect and address hidden moisture. |
| Water damage with insurance claims or documentation | No | Yes | Professionals can help navigate the insurance process and ensure accurate documentation. |

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ost in Fairfield, UT
Prices v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Fairfield, UT.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process |
| Mold Remediation |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and extent of remediation required |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$3,000 – $15,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and extent of repairs required |
| Odor Removal |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of odor removal method used |
| Documentation and Insurance Claims |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of insurance claims process and extent of documentation required |
